| Subject: some awkward behaviour Mon Aug 16, 2010 4:43 am | |
| my female bristlenose randomly ust swims to the top of the tank and goes back down... shes done it more than 20 times | |

| she is gulping air for the surface. It means that your O2 in the tank is low. best thing to do is to wack an airstone in there. if you dont have an air pump or are unable to for some reason then move the filter so that the outflow causes ripples on the surface.
Bristlenose are sensitive to O2 levels as they come from a whitewater habitat where O2 is at 100% all the time | |

| how does the airpump put the air into the water? an airstone is a very porous bit of rock that causes the air to bubble out in very fine bubbles. they are the single best way to oxygenate your water | |

| yeah, thats a modified airstone, commonly called an air curtain. I wuld suggest that with that running your water has plenty of O2 in it.
Next thing to check would be to see what she is actually doing when she goes up. Does she break the surface? if so do you see her blowing bubbles past her gills as she dropps back down? If she is doing that then she is still gasping which could indicate one of the other water parameters is a bit off, pH, high ammonia, high temp, etc. will all cause this.
fi she isnt breaking the surface but just shooting upwards then she could be trying to avoid some sort of conflict or fight.
I think the best best is to try and see what happens just before and during these runs to the top. | |
